Jumble of Thoughts

To quill I must fly
I need to scribe
put pen to paper
words tumbling out

little sense they make
I score them out
These words, they seethe
such a jumble of thoughts

I stop, I pause,
I think of yore
of famous poets
sadly no more

wonder, yet know
that they too did
anguish over each line
just a seething broth

A jumble, a jumble of words
they tumble over each other
each one fighting to be heard
